I just realised that I play several sorts of tricks to make my hotter weather runs work out better. Like this evening:
- I waited until the sun is about setting before heading out. (cooler pavement, breezes, lower sunburn risk)
- I wore a long sleeve, light weight tech shirt that I soaked in cool water just before I headed out. (it's like my own personal Air Conditioner, for the first mile or so, at least)
- I kept my mouth closed as much as possible. (controls pace, maybe, and I'm pretty sure I don't feel as dehydrated as quickly if my mouth stays wet)
